Considering the cost and function of the certificate, how is the shared SSL going to work? The cert is based on the site name.
www.netwerkin.com
SteveNJ
05-29-2003, 06:47 AM
The way I've seen it before is shared usually means you share DiscountAsp.net's cert and address.
Addresses are sort of like: https://secure.yoursitename.discountasp.net
or something along that lines.
Downside of shared is you show someone elses domain, upside is cost.
